1993 Volvo 240

Introduction:

The 1993 Volvo 240 is a classic Swedish sedan renowned for its durability, safety, and boxy aesthetic. It came equipped with a range of engine and transmission options, including the B230F four-cylinder and B230FK turbocharged four-cylinder engines, paired with either a 4-speed automatic or 5-speed manual transmission. The 240 is appreciated for its roomy interior, comfortable ride, and reliable performance, while common complaints include its outdated design and lack of modern amenities.

Engine

B230F

  • Head gasket failure: Leaking or blown head gasket can cause coolant and oil mixing, overheating, and decreased engine power.
    • Solution: Replace head gasket, inspect and resurface cylinder head and block as necessary
    • Estimated Cost to Fix: $1,000 - $2,000+
    • Recalls: None Found
  • Intake manifold gasket failure: Leaking intake manifold gasket can cause a vacuum leak, leading to poor engine performance and increased emissions.
    • Solution: Replace intake manifold gasket
    • Estimated Cost to Fix: $300 - $500+
    • Recalls: None Found

B230FK

  • Turbocharger failure: Failed turbocharger can result in reduced boost pressure, decreased engine power, and excessive oil consumption.
    • Solution: Replace turbocharger
    • Estimated Cost to Fix: $1,500 - $2,500+
    • Recalls: None Found

Transmission

4-speed Automatic

  • Transmission slipping: Worn or damaged clutch packs or bands can cause the transmission to slip, resulting in poor acceleration and shifting performance.
    • Solution: Rebuild or replace transmission
    • Estimated Cost to Fix: $1,500 - $3,000+
    • Recalls: None Found

5-speed Manual

  • Clutch failure: Worn or damaged clutch disc or pressure plate can make it difficult to engage gears, causing slipping or chattering.
    • Solution: Replace clutch kit (disc, pressure plate, release bearing)
    • Estimated Cost to Fix: $600 - $1,000+
    • Recalls: None Found

Suspension

  • Strut mount failure: Worn or damaged strut mounts can cause excessive noise, vibration, and decreased handling.
    • Solution: Replace strut mounts
    • Estimated Cost to Fix: $200 - $300+
    • Recalls: None Found
  • Control arm bushings failure: Failed control arm bushings can cause clunking noises, poor alignment, and decreased handling.
    • Solution: Replace control arm bushings
    • Estimated Cost to Fix: $150 - $250+
    • Recalls: None Found

Electrical

  • Alternator failure: Failed alternator can lead to a loss of electrical power, causing the battery to drain and the vehicle to stall.
    • Solution: Replace alternator
    • Estimated Cost to Fix: $300 - $500+
    • Recalls: None Found
  • Starter failure: Failed starter can prevent the engine from starting, causing difficulty or inability to start the vehicle.
    • Solution: Replace starter
    • Estimated Cost to Fix: $200 - $300+
    • Recalls: None Found

Exterior

  • Rust: The 240 is prone to rust, especially in cold climates or areas with high salt exposure.
    • Solution: Preventative measures include regular washing, waxing, and undercoating to protect the metal from corrosion.
    • Estimated Cost to Fix: Varies depending on severity of rust damage
    • Recalls: None Found

Interior

  • Odometer failure: In some models, the odometer may malfunction or fail, causing inaccurate mileage readings.
    • Solution: Repair or replace odometer assembly
    • Estimated Cost to Fix: $150 - $300+
    • Recalls: None Found

Summary:

The 1993 Volvo 240 is generally a reliable vehicle, but it is not without its issues. Some of the more common problems include head gasket failure, intake manifold gasket failure, transmission slipping, strut mount failure, and rust. While the severity of these issues varies, they can be costly to repair, especially in the case of a transmission or engine failure.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ent or identify these issues early on, saving owners time and money in the long run.
